Home
CHEVROLET
EQUINOX
2011
2CNALDEC6B6261368
2011 CHEVROLET EQUINOX LT W 1LT vin: 2CNALDEC6B6261368
2021-01-19 (12 photos) Odometer: 182339
Unlock these pics for $2.99